A type of light that was previously thought to be impossible may be real after all. Creating it would involve “splitting” a single photon of light between two locations to produce particles called Majorana bosons.

In 1937, Italian physicist Ettore Majorana suggested that some electrons, which fall into a category of particles called fermions, could be split into two theoretical particles called Majorana fermions.
